Q&A with Goldman MD: how to EMpower emerging markets

Jonathan Bayliss, a managing director at Goldman Sachs Asset management, who also chairs emerging markets charity EMpower in the UK, speaks to FN

EMpower, a charity founded by a group of emerging markets bankers in support of young people in developing countries, raised a staggering $1.3 million at its annual fundraising dinner this week.

A string of senior bankers and investment managers came together at One Mayfair. The charity is supported by a number of high profile institutions and individuals, including Citigroup's global head of markets Paco Ybarra.
